What the college says
Level 2 • Speaking, Listening and Communication – make a range of contributions to discussions in a range of contexts, including those that are unfamiliar, and make effective presentations. • Reading – select, read, understand and compare texts and use them to gather information, ideas, arguments and opinions. • Writing – write a range of texts, including extended written documents communication information, ideas and opinions, effectively and persuasively.
